  • Clare's story from PNG

    Clare, 27, lives in the remote Southern Highlands of Papua New Guinea (PNG), an area rich in oil and gas, with a history of tribal fighting and natural disasters.

    Caritas Australia is working with the local communities to increase confidence in and utilisation of existing health services.

    "I have been working the past three years at Det Health Centre," says Clare. "In the mornings I do a ward round then help the out-patients, the maternity ward, and with administration and weeding the gardens. The biggest health problem is malaria – that can cause complications, especially with anemia,” Clare explains. Read Clare's story  »»
  • Caritas swings into action in Chile

    Chile disaster reliefCaritas in Chile is already delivering assistance in some of the worst affected areas of Chile following the massive earthquake of Saturday 27 February.

    “The magnitude and depth of the catastrophe which has affected the poorest regions of the country will require the support of Caritas members in Latin America and worldwide. Above all, hope is needed among our suffering people, ” says Caritas Chile Director Lorenzo Figueroa.

    "Caritas Chile is working in coordination with governmental and civil society organisations ..." Read more »»
